Comparison of Pelvic Floor Muscle Function Between Sexually Active and Sexually Inactive Women with Pelvic Floor Dysfunction: Retrospective Cross-Sectional Study

Sexual performance is influenced by pelvic floor muscle (PFM) function. The hypothesis is that sexually active women with pelvic floor dysfunction (PFD) would have better PFM function compared with sexually inactive women. This study was aimed at comparing PFM function between sexually active and inactive women with PFD.
MethodsThis retrospective, cross-sectional study included women over 18 years of age diagnosed with PFD, divided into two groups based on sexual activity, as determined by a structured questionnaire. PFM function was assessed via bidigital palpation using the Power, Endurance, Repetitions, Fast contractions, and Every Contraction Timed scheme. Mann–Whitney, likelihood ratio tests, post hoc power and multivariate regression analyses were conducted, with a significance level of p < 0.05.
ResultsA total of 229 charts were analyzed (117 sexually active, 112 sexually inactive women). Sexually active women demonstrated significantly better PFM function in terms of strength (p < 0.001), endurance (p < 0.001), and fast contractions (p < 0.001). Post hoc analysis revealed an overall study power of 0.93. Sexually active women had a fivefold greater chance of presenting better muscle function (OR 5.04; IC 95% 2.6–9.6, p < 0.001), longer endurance (+3.5; IC 95% 2.1–4.9; p<0.001) and a higher number of fast contractions (+1.2; IC 95% 0.56–1.84; p < 0.001). Increasing age reduces the PFM strength (p = 0.029), muscular endurance (p = 0.008), and fast contractions (p = 0.054). Menopause status reduces muscular endurance in 1.8 s (p = 0.005) and increase fast contractions in 0.8 (p = 0.021). Marital status and urinary incontinence were not associated with PFM function.
ConclusionsSexually active women with PFD exhibit superior pelvic floor muscle function compared with sexually inactive women.
